I don't know how others rate the free event calendar included with Dolphin 7 but I myself find some features lacking. Yes, it is nice to be able to upload images, videos, rich html text for the event details with various permission switches available for editing, etc but some basic calendar functionality is just outright missing. For example, the month view just shows the number of events on a particular day, which is not very descriptive. And how about having a draggable block in the page builder to display the calendar on other pages, like the front page for example?
So my cheap workaround is this:
I create the event in the event calendar with all the images, all the aesthetically pleasing stuff I want. Grab the ink to the individual event and then create a corresponding entry in google calendar. Fortunately, google calendar allows html links, though not much else besides plain text in the event details section. But that's all I need for this workaround. I then add some basic information - date, time, address and then include the link to the event calendar detail.
Now just grab the iframe code from the google calendar settings, customize to correct width and then plop it in an html block on the front page of my page builder in Dolphin. I now have a nice google calendar with each entry pointing to the corresponding event in my event calendar.
